The reason I am requesting help is because this past year I quit my job to go back to school. We are living on one salary and don't have the extra funds to get Lucky healthy and out of pain. He is no longer walking on his front right leg because of how much pain he is in.
Lucky started to grow a lump on his right wrist. After taking him to 2 vets and a specialist, they was determined that he has Osteosarcoma. The treatment includes amputation of the from right leg. After the leg is amputated and sent to be tested we will then know if Chemotherapy is necessary. The surgery will be preformed at Liberty Grove Animal Hospital by Dr. Michelle Hoag.
